We also know that protecting your customers and employees is top of mind, and the Tacoma-Pierce County Health Department provides these recommendations.


In addition, as you experience impacts or have questions regarding your workforce, the Employment Security Department has guidelines for workers and businesses as well as a reference guide to programs available in the state under different scenarios.

We’ll update you as soon as the SBA’s Economic Injury Disaster Loan Program goes into effect to assist small businesses that have been severely impacted by COVID-19. In addition, the Washington State Governor’s Office is compiling resources to support businesses, including the State Department of Revenue’s relief for taxpayers and insurance information from the Office of the Insurance Commissioner.
